Preheat your oven and prep your pan

Before you even think about mixing ingredients, pre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). This step ensures that your Healthy Raspberry Cheesecake Bars bake evenly, resulting in that perfect creamy texture.

While the oven warms up, grab an 8×8-inch baking pan and line it with parchment paper. Make sure to leave some overhang on the edges; this makes it easier to lift the bars out once they’ve cooled. If you don’t have parchment paper, a light spray of cooking oil will do the trick as well.

Make the base mixture

Now it’s time to create a base that’s both satisfying and healthy. In a medium bowl, combine:

  • 1 cup oats (gluten-free, if necessary)
  • ¼ cup almond flour
  • ¼ cup melted coconut oil
  • 2 tablespoons maple syrup or honey

Mix these ingredients together until well combined. The texture should resemble wet sand. Pour this mixture into your prepared pan and press it down firmly into an even layer. This will become the delightful crust of your Healthy Raspberry Cheesecake Bars.

Combine the cheesecake ingredients

In a large mixing bowl, it’s time to make the cheesecake filling! You’ll need:

  • 1 cup low-fat cream cheese
  • 1/2 cup Greek yogurt
  • 1/3 cup maple syrup or honey
  • 1 tablespoon vanilla extract
  • 2 large eggs

Using an electric mixer, blend these ingredients until smooth and creamy. Make sure to scrape down the sides to ensure everything is well incorporated. This is where the magic happens—creating that rich cheesecake flavor without the extra calories!

Layer the cheesecake with raspberries

Next, it’s time to fold in the star ingredient—raspberries! Gently add 1 cup of fresh raspberries into the cheesecake filling. Be careful not to crush them; you want those lovely bursts of berry throughout the bars. Pour the cheesecake mixture on top of the prepared crust, spreading it evenly.

For an artistic touch, you can also scatter a few extra raspberries on top before baking. These not only add a pop of color but also make for a beautiful presentation!

Bake your cheesecake bars

Now place your pan in the preheated oven and bake for about 25-30 minutes. You’ll know they are done when the edges are set, and the center has a slight jiggle. Remember, they will continue to firm up while they cool, so don’t be tempted to overbake!

Chill and set your bars

Once baked, remove the bars from the oven and allow them to cool in the pan for at least 15 minutes. After that, transfer them to the refrigerator and chill for at least 2 hours (or overnight for best results). This chilling step is vital for bringing out the flavors and ensuring your Healthy Raspberry Cheesecake Bars slice beautifully.

When you’re ready to serve, use the overhanging parchment paper to lift the bars from the pan, then cut them into squares. They’re the perfect snack for busy young professionals—simple, healthy, and crave-worthy!

Can I substitute Greek yogurt in this recipe?

Absolutely! Greek yogurt is a popular choice because it adds creaminess and a bit of tang. However, if you’re looking for alternatives, you can use regular plain yogurt or even cottage cheese blended until smooth. Each substitute will give a slightly different texture, so feel free to experiment!

How long can I store these cheesecake bars?

These delicious Healthy Raspberry Cheesecake Bars can be stored in the refrigerator for up to 5 days. Just make sure they’re tightly wrapped or placed in an airtight container to maintain their freshness. You can also freeze them for longer storage; they should last in the freezer for about 2-3 months. When you’re ready to enjoy, simply thaw them in the fridge overnight!

Is there a non-dairy option for the cream cheese?

Yes, there are fantastic non-dairy cream cheese substitutes available! Brands like Tofutti and Kite Hill offer delicious alternatives that work wonderfully in this recipe. Just keep an eye on the ingredients to ensure they align with your dietary preferences. For a homemade option, try blending silken tofu with a bit of lemon juice and maple syrup for a creamy texture.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 ½ cups almond flour
  • ¼ cup maple syrup
  • ¼ cup coconut oil, melted
  • 1 ½ cups cream cheese, softened
  • ½ cup Greek yogurt
  • ½ cup honey
  • 2 large eggs
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1 cup fresh raspberries

Instructions

  1.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C).
  2. In a bowl, mix almond flour, maple syrup, and melted coconut oil until combined.
  3. Press the mixture into a greased baking dish to form the crust.
  4. In another bowl, beat together the cream cheese, Greek yogurt, honey, eggs, and vanilla extract until smooth.
  5. Pour the filling over the crust and swirl in the fresh raspberries.
  6. Bake for 25-30 minutes or until the center is set.
  7. Let cool before cutting into bars.
